What is a byte boundary?

Each byte is 8 bits, so to align on a 16 byte boundary, you need to align to each set of two bytes. Similarly, memory aligned on a 32 bit (4 byte) boundary would have a memory address that’s a multiple of four, because you group four bytes together to form a 32 bit word.

Why do we align data?

Alignment helps the CPU fetch data from memory in an efficient manner: less cache miss/flush, less bus transactions etc. Some memory types (e.g. RDRAM, DRAM etc.) need to be accessed in a structured manner (aligned “words” and in “burst transactions” i.e. many words at one time) in order to yield efficient results.

How many padding bytes are needed to align a structure?

The following formulas provide the number of padding bytes required to align the start of a data structure (where mod is the modulo operator): For example, the padding to add to offset 0x59d for a 4-byte aligned structure is 3. The structure will then start at 0x5a0, which is a multiple of 4.

When to insert a padding byte in structb _ T?

The compiler will insert a padding byte after the char to ensure short int will have an address multiple of 2 (i.e. 2 byte aligned). The total size of structa_t will be sizeof (char) + 1 (padding) + sizeof (short), 1 + 1 + 2 = 4 bytes. The first member of structb_t is short int followed by char.

How to minimize padding in structure member alignment?

By now, it may be clear that padding is unavoidable. There is a way to minimize padding. The programmer should declare the structure members in their increasing/decreasing order of size.
